问题描述
我试图分叉此react native模块进行一些更正,因为作者放弃了该项目,而他是我发现的唯一工具并且满足了我的需求,因此阅读我发现的有关分叉的文章后,我执行了此过程,然后仅在必须使用
将模块添加到我的react项目中时,我才克隆并进行必要的更正添加lucassouza16 / react-native-svg-uri
我收到此错误:
错误找不到二进制git
我的分叉存储库:
https://github.com/lucassouza16/react-native-svg-uri
原始存储库:
https://github.com/vault-development/react-native-svg-uri
解决方法
要通过npm或yarn添加它,您首先需要将其添加到npm注册表中。在这里,您可以了解有关https://docs.npmjs.com/packages-and-modules/contributing-packages-to-the-registry
的更多信息您还可以通过github添加,如下所示:
yarn add git+https://github.com/lucassouza16/react-native-svg-uri.git
您可以在此处了解更多信息: How to install an npm package from GitHub directly?
,最后,所有回复都导致了相同的错误,但是要感谢所有尝试帮助我的人,但是当我添加发行版时,它是有效的,这是正确的格式:
添加纱线lucassouza16 / react-native-svg-uri#1.2 .4